
The Evolution of Speed in Warfare
From the early days of modern warfare, speed has played a crucial role in determining success on the battlefield. The Cold War era marked a fascinating chapter in this evolution, especially between the United States and the Soviet Union. As tensions ran high, both superpowers accelerated their technological advancements, with a primary focus on achieving speed through air and missile technology.
Breaking Barriers: The Dawn of Supersonic Flight
In the aftermath of World War II, the U.S. recognized that outnumbering the Soviet forces was not a viable strategy. Instead, it leaned heavily into innovation, primarily in aviation. Edwards Air Force Base became a critical hub for test flights, where aviation pioneer Chuck Yeager famously broke the sound barrier in 1947. This remarkable feat ignited a race to develop supersonic aircraft, resulting in legendary models like the SR-71 Blackbird. Not only was this aircraft capable of flying at speeds exceeding Mach 3, but it could also evade radar detection while cruising at altitudes of 85,000 feet.
Missile Revolution: Speed Redefined
The development of intercontinental ballistic missiles (ICBMs) fundamentally transformed warfare. Prior to these advancements, aircraft like the B-29 took hours to reach their targets. In stark contrast, ICBMs could deliver a nuclear payload worldwide in less than an hour. The Titan I, introduced in the 1960s, showcased speeds up to Mach 21, increasing the stakes in military strategies globally.
The Present: Maneuverability Over Speed
As the Cold War drew to a close, the focus shifted from sheer speed to maneuverability in fighter aircraft. However, the quest for speed remained alive, pivoting toward a new area of interest: hypersonic weaponry. Hypersonic technology is defined as achieving speeds greater than Mach 5. What distinguishes hypersonic weapons is not just their velocity; it's their ability to maneuver within the atmosphere, creating challenges for traditional missile defense systems.
The Future of Warfare: Hypersonics at the Forefront
Hypersonic technology encompasses two main types of weapons: hypersonic cruise missiles and hypersonic glide vehicles, each designed for unique functionalities and tactical advantages. Their ability to evade defenses and strike targets with little warning poses a significant technological challenge, prompting nations to advance their military capabilities rapidly.
